DESCRIPTION
Yahoo! Inc. was founded in 1994. Yahoo! Inc., together with its consolidated subsidiaries is a premier digital media company. Through its proprietary technology and insights, it delivers personalized digital content and experiences, across devices and around the globe, to vast audiences. It provides engaging and innovative canvases for advertisers to connect with their target audiences using its unique blend of Science + Art + Scale. It provide online properties and services to users as well as a range of marketing services designed to reach and connect with those users on Yahoo! and through a distribution network of third-party entities. The Company’s offerings to users on Yahoo! Properties currently fall into three categories: Communications and Communities; Search and Marketplaces; and Media. The majority of its offerings are available in more than 45 languages and in 60 countries, regions, and territories. It has properties tailored to users in specific international markets including Yahoo! Homepage and social networking Websites such as Meme and Wretch. It manages and measures its business geographically, mainly in the Americas, EMEA (Europe, Middle East, and Africa) and Asia Pacific. Its Communications and Communities offerings, including Yahoo! Mail, Yahoo! Messenger, Yahoo! Groups, Yahoo! Answers, Flickr, and Connected TV, provide a range of communication and social services to users across a variety of devices and through its broadband Internet access partners, OEM partners and strategic partners. These offerings enable users to organize into groups and share knowledge, common interests, and photos. Its Search and Marketplaces offerings are designed to quickly answer users’ information needs by delivering innovative and meaningful search, local, and listings experiences on the search results pages and across Yahoo!. Its Marketplaces offerings and services include Yahoo! Shopping, Yahoo! Travel, Yahoo! Real Estate, Yahoo! Autos, and Yahoo! Small Business. On these properties, users can research specific topics, products, services or areas of interest by reviewing and exchanging information, obtaining contact details or considering offers from providers of goods, providers of services, or parties with similar interests. It generate revenue from listing fees, transaction fees, and display and search advertising on many of these properties, as well as from the subscription fees that it charge for hosting Websites for its customers, fees that it charge for registering domains, and fees that it charge for services it provide to small businesses seeking to maintain a Website. Its Media offerings are designed to engage users with some of the relevant and compelling online content and services on the Web. It offers a majority of these services free of charge to its users. On its Media properties, it generates revenue from display and search advertising and from fee-based services. Its Media properties and services include: Yahoo! Homepage, Yahoo! News, Yahoo! Sports, Yahoo! Finance, My Yahoo!, Yahoo! Toolbar, Yahoo! Entertainment & Lifestyles, IntoNow from Yahoo!, Yahoo! Contributor Network. Its competitors are Facebook, Google, Microsoft, and AOL, which each generally offer an integrated variety of Internet products, services, and/or content. It competes with these and other companies for users, advertisers, publishers, and developers. It also compete with these companies to obtain agreements with software publishers, Internet access providers, mobile carriers, device manufacturers and others to promote or distribute its services to their users. The Company is subject to regulations and laws directly applicable to providers of Internet, mobile and VOIP services both domestically and internationally.
